Several actions can get you in trouble in Japan. Being disruptive in public spaces, such as talking loudly on trains, can be frowned upon. Respect local rules and customs, including proper disposal of trash and maintaining decorum in public baths. Drug offenses are taken extremely seriously. Observing these etiquettes ensures responsible and respectful behavior while visiting Japan.
